Question
find the missing side length. assume that all intersecting sides meet at right angles. include the correct unit in your answer.
Step1: Analyze vertical side - lengths
The total vertical length on the left is 12 ft. The vertical length on the right part of the figure is composed of two segments with lengths 8 ft and 4 ft. Since all sides meet at right - angles, the vertical lengths on both sides of the figure must be equal in total.
Step2: Analyze horizontal side - lengths
The total horizontal length at the bottom is 15 ft. The horizontal length on the top part of the figure is 6 ft. Let the missing horizontal side - length be $x$. We know that the sum of horizontal lengths on the top must equal the sum of horizontal lengths on the bottom. So, $6 + x=15$.
Step3: Solve for the missing side - length
Subtract 6 from both sides of the equation $6 + x = 15$. We get $x=15 - 6=9$ ft.
